
Have you ever wondered what Trendelenburg's Sign is and why it's important? Trendelenburg's Sign is a clinical test used to assess the strength and function of the hip abductor muscles, particularly the gluteus medius and minimus. When these muscles are weak, the pelvis drops on the side opposite to the stance leg during walking. This can indicate various conditions, such as hip dysplasia, nerve damage, or muscular dystrophy. Understanding this sign can help in diagnosing and treating hip-related issues. What is Trendelenburg's Sign?
Trendelenburg's Sign is a clinical test used to identify weakness in the hip abductor muscles, particularly the gluteus medius and minimus. Named after German surgeon Friedrich Trendelenburg, this test is often used in orthopedics and physical therapy.
- 01Trendelenburg's Sign is named after Friedrich Trendelenburg, a German surgeon who first described it in the late 19th century.
- 02The test is primarily used to assess the strength of the hip abductor muscles, especially the gluteus medius and minimus.
- 03A positive Trendelenburg's Sign indicates weakness in these muscles, which can lead to an abnormal gait.
- 04The test is performed by having the patient stand on one leg while the examiner observes the position of the pelvis.
- 05If the pelvis drops on the side opposite to the standing leg, it is considered a positive Trendelenburg's Sign.
How is Trendelenburg's Sign Performed?
Performing the Trendelenburg test is straightforward but requires careful observation. Here’s how it’s done:
- 06The patient is asked to stand on one leg for about 30 seconds.
- 07The examiner watches the pelvis from behind to see if it stays level or drops.
- 08A drop in the pelvis on the side opposite to the standing leg suggests a positive Trendelenburg's Sign.
- 09The test can be performed on both legs to compare the strength of the hip abductors on each side.
- 10It’s important for the patient to keep their hands on their hips to avoid using their arms for balance.
Clinical Significance of Trendelenburg's Sign
Understanding the clinical implications of a positive Trendelenburg's Sign can help in diagnosing various conditions.
- 11A positive Trendelenburg's Sign often indicates weakness in the gluteus medius and minimus muscles.
- 12This weakness can be due to nerve damage, muscle atrophy, or hip joint problems.
- 13Conditions like hip dysplasia, arthritis, and congenital hip dislocation can also result in a positive Trendelenburg's Sign.
- 14It is commonly seen in patients with superior gluteal nerve injury.
- 15Trendelenburg's Sign can also be an indicator of conditions like polio and muscular dystrophy.
Causes of a Positive Trendelenburg's Sign
Several factors can lead to a positive Trendelenburg's Sign. Here are some common causes:
- 16Hip abductor muscle weakness is the most common cause.
- 17Damage to the superior gluteal nerve can impair muscle function, leading to a positive sign.
- 18Hip joint problems such as arthritis or hip dysplasia can also cause a positive Trendelenburg's Sign.
- 19Congenital conditions like hip dislocation can result in a positive sign.
- 20Muscle atrophy due to lack of use or neuromuscular diseases can weaken the hip abductors.
Treatment Options for a Positive Trendelenburg's Sign
Addressing a positive Trendelenburg's Sign involves treating the underlying cause. Here are some treatment options:
- 21Physical therapy can help strengthen the hip abductor muscles.
- 22Exercises like side-lying leg lifts and hip abduction can improve muscle strength.
- 23In cases of nerve damage, nerve repair or grafting may be necessary.
- 24For hip joint problems, treatments may include medication, physical therapy, or surgery.
- 25Orthopedic interventions like hip replacement may be required for severe arthritis or hip dysplasia.
Exercises to Improve Hip Abductor Strength
Strengthening the hip abductors can help correct a positive Trendelenburg's Sign. Here are some effective exercises:
- 26Side-lying leg lifts target the gluteus medius and minimus muscles.
- 27Standing hip abduction exercises can be done with or without resistance bands.
- 28Clamshell exercises are great for activating the hip abductors.
- 29Lateral band walks help strengthen the hip muscles while improving stability.
- 30Single-leg squats can also improve hip abductor strength and balance.
Diagnosing Trendelenburg's Sign in Children
Trendelenburg's Sign can also be seen in children, particularly those with congenital hip conditions.
- 31Pediatricians often use the Trendelenburg test to assess hip stability in children.
- 32Conditions like developmental dysplasia of the hip (DDH) can cause a positive Trendelenburg's Sign in children.
- 33Early diagnosis and treatment are crucial to prevent long-term complications.
- 34In children, treatment may include bracing, physical therapy, or surgery.
- 35Regular follow-up is essential to monitor the progress and effectiveness of the treatment.
Trendelenburg's Sign in Athletes
Athletes are not immune to a positive Trendelenburg's Sign. Here’s how it affects them:
- 36Athletes, especially runners, may develop a positive Trendelenburg's Sign due to overuse injuries.
- 37Hip abductor weakness in athletes can lead to poor performance and increased risk of injury.
- 38Strengthening exercises and proper training techniques can help prevent a positive Trendelenburg's Sign in athletes.
- 39Sports physical therapists often include hip abductor strengthening in rehabilitation programs for athletes.
- 40Regular assessment and conditioning can help athletes maintain hip stability and prevent injuries.
